Google Search Console is a powerful tool that helps website owners and digital marketers understand how users find and interact with their site. One of its key features is providing insights into user search intent, which can improve your SEO strategy and content planning.
Understanding Search Intent
Search intent refers to the reason behind a user’s query. Common types include informational, navigational, transactional, and commercial investigation. Recognizing these types helps tailor your content to meet user needs and improve your search rankings.
Using Google Search Console for Insights
Google Search Console provides valuable data through its Performance report. This report shows the queries, pages, countries, devices, and search appearance that bring visitors to your site. Analyzing this data helps you understand what users are searching for and their intent.
Step 1: Access the Performance Report
Log in to your Google Search Console account and select your website property. Click on the “Performance” tab in the menu. Here, you’ll see a summary of your site’s search performance, including total clicks, impressions, average CTR, and position.
Step 2: Analyze Search Queries
Scroll down to the “Queries” section. This list shows the search terms users entered to find your site. Look for high-impression queries with low CTR, indicating potential for optimization.
Step 3: Identify User Intent
Examine the queries to determine user intent. For example:
- Informational: Queries like “history of the Renaissance” suggest users seek knowledge.
- Navigational: Searches like “Wikipedia Renaissance” indicate users want a specific site.
- Transactional: Phrases like “buy Renaissance art” show purchase intent.
- Commercial Investigation: Queries such as “best Renaissance art books” reflect comparison shopping.
Applying Insights to Your Content Strategy
Once you’ve identified user intent, tailor your content accordingly. For informational searches, create detailed articles. For transactional intent, optimize product pages. Understanding intent helps increase engagement and conversions.
